Diamond breakfast cold food only? by rednyellowcy in Hilton

[–]zazvm 0 points1 point  (0 children)

So from what I remember, Doubletree properties in Canada are only required to provide a continental breakfast, not a hot breakfast to G/D members per MyWay benefits. In the US, Doubletree hotels more commonly provide a credit towards breakfast for Gold and Diamond members, rather than including it via MyWay benefits.

As Canada seems to be mirroring the US trend to more and more provide the least amenities while still remaining within brand standards to save money, it is not so surprising that a hot breakfast would not be provided.

This does differ from Europe and Asia markets, where Doubletree properties often provide a continental and hot breakfast as part of the benefit due to necessity from similar amenities being offered at comparable properties.

100% bonus by Roscoejoe434 in Hilton

[–]zazvm 13 points14 points  (0 children)

Points are only worth ~0.5-0.6 cents. You are paying 1 cent per point here without the bonus, which means you are paying twice their value. They then tell you they will give you a 100% bonus, but all that means is that you are buying them for what they are worth (1.0/2=0.5). At best you are converting USD into perhaps a similar value, but less usable currency.

Anyone ever mess around with Klip Dagga? Cool and beautiful plant to grow but how would you use it? by poopshipdestroyer34 in druggardening

[–]zazvm 1 point2 points  (0 children)

This is Leonotis nepetifolia and it’s not the droid you want for cannabinoid-type effects. Leonotis leonurus or Wild Dagga or Lions ear contains the primary molecule thought to be responsible for these effects called adrenoyl-ethanolamide (a weak Cannibanoid receptor 1 agonist), along with leonurine and labdane diterpenes that also act on CB₁, saw well as having some other complementary TRP and GABA pathways. L. nepetifolia has not been shown to have adrenoyl-EA and only produces mild, non-euphoric effects in most people. It does have some leonurine, but leonurus has about twice as much leonurine (~0.32–0.45 mg/g DW vs. 0.10–0.20 mg/g). The psychoactive compounds that do exist in nepetifolia are in the greatest concentrations in the leaves and flowers. Non chronic use of nepetifolia by smoking or tea has not been shown to be harmful in recreational amounts, so if you want to see for yourself you would most likely be fine. Fungus issues with takeaway tek, again by Adamsmasher23 in sanpedrocactus

[–]zazvm 4 points5 points  (0 children)

Those are root hairs from the seed, not hyphae. Here is a guide showing and explaining the difference. Also, if it were fungal, you would likely be able to smell it ime. There would be a strange, funky sort of smell. When there are fibers in a regular fan-shaped organization, they are not hyphae.
